The Indonesia 1,000 Rupiah Banknote was issued by the Bank Indonesia in 2016. It has a color combination of green, orange, and purple. On the obverse are the coat of arms of Indonesia and a portrait of Kapitan Pattimura with a machete. The reverse of the note depicts the Maitara and Tidore islands, two men on a boat on a lake with mountains and clouds in the background. The banknote contains a solid security thread with printed BANK INDONESIA and a watermark that reveals Tjut Meutia. It is 141 x 65 mm in size and is in uncirculated condition.
